The Importance of Demos in Gaming
Demos serve several vital functions in the gaming industry, particularly for new releases. Here are some key reasons why Crown Green demo versions are significant:
- Player Engagement: Demos help engage players by allowing them to experience the gameplay firsthand. This engagement can convert hesitant gamers into loyal customers.
- Feedback Collection: By allowing players to test the game, Crown Green can collect feedback on gameplay, glitches, and feature requests, which can be instrumental for improvements.
- Marketing Strategy: A well-designed demo serves as a marketing tool, generating buzz and anticipation for the full release of a game.

3. Demo Fatigue
As more games offer demo versions, some players express concerns about “demo fatigue.” They feel overwhelmed by the sheer number of demos available today, leading them to become indifferent to trying new games. Crown Green must find a balance in releasing demos that stand out and offer unique value. Otherwise, it risks losing potential players to this fatigue.
